Output cb26c89ef4c6be24f1435b51fe68ca2f544072b64228e872fb5ba5d3c549564b:0

value
19999912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d302dea5b6a95c5df54659bbe44e79ec4eaddbc OP_EQUAL
address
3Qmkbdv4PgZfBgqfPMTKcSCvJ6ZW5yRc6T
transaction
cb26c89ef4c6be24f1435b51fe68ca2f544072b64228e872fb5ba5d3c549564b
spent
true